Current Work

For the past several years, I have specialized in photographing horses and their riders both in New Mexico and California. I experimented for several years using a slow shutter while photographing the Rodeo in New Mexico.

I found the images could show the dancelike movement of the riders when the actual image showed movement as well. The gestures were similar to Flamenco dance, and were reminiscent of that art form.

My most recent work focuses on the bond between horses and their riders, and many times, just the beauty of the equine athlete and its rider. The two in combination are always the result of immense dedication and training. The challenge is to find those images amongst thousands that hold the essence of the beauty and the bond, and can live on to tell the story that is worth telling.
